A recent social media video has captured widespread attention, showcasing a series of humorous, AI-generated clips of various animals and even objects seemingly jumping on trampolines. The video, uploaded by user 'katie_howard04,' features footage of a bear, a raccoon, an octopus, a pig, an elephant, a truck, a narwhal, and a T-rex, all appearing to bounce on trampolines, often presented in a night-vision security camera style. The creator expressed playful exasperation, stating, "I fell for the bear on the trampoline and my husband WILL NOT LET IT GO." Comments on the video reflect similar experiences, with one user remarking, "Same with me but my husband sent me a trampoline jumping on a trampoline 😭." Another comment highlighted the AI aspect, saying, "My dad would see the narwhal and instantly know it was AI. Not because he’s good at detecting AI but because he genuinely thinks narwhals are made up." The video has resonated with many, highlighting the growing trend of creative and often absurd AI-generated content shared between individuals.
